 Description   

Webhooks are a popular pattern for lightweight integrations in CMS. 

Currently it is already easy for developers to configure REST clients in order to make requests to 3rd party systems.

With this improvement, developers will be able to easily configure full webhooks by providing triggers for the REST clients. Developers will have triggers for the common use cases such as when content is changed or a publishing workflow runs. Webhooks are commonly used to trigger CI/CD systems, for example to rebuild a static site when content changes - aka "jamstack".
